1995 Audi 90 vs. 2005 Audi TT

To start off, 2005 Audi TT is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1995 Audi 90.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1995 Audi 90 would be higher. At 2,801 cc (6 cylinders), 1995 Audi 90 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Audi TT (247 HP) has 77 more horse power than 1995 Audi 90. (170 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Audi TT should accelerate faster than 1995 Audi 90.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1995 Audi 90 weights approximately 57 kg more than 2005 Audi TT.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Audi TT (321 Nm) has 70 more torque (in Nm) than 1995 Audi 90. (251 Nm). This means 2005 Audi TT will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1995 Audi 90.

Compare all specifications:

1995 Audi 90 2005 Audi TT
Make Audi Audi
Model 90 TT
Year Released 1995 2005
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2801 cc 1781 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 170 HP 247 HP
Torque 251 Nm 321 Nm
Drive Type 4WD 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 1447 kg 1390 kg
Vehicle Length 4590 mm 4050 mm
Vehicle Width 1700 mm 1770 mm
Vehicle Height 1390 mm 1350 mm
Wheelbase Size 2620 mm 2440 mm
